Handover Note — Regional Sales Review

Hi Renna, quick handover before I'm off to the Caldmere offsite. The southern region numbers are mostly tidied up — Brelton branch still owes us corrected figures for the Orvana product line. Push Talis if he stalls. Margins look soft but recoverable. Finance has the working file. One more thing you'll need before the review, noted below in confidence.

board note of hahaf-fahog: The pricing group signed off on a budget of $229.3 million for Project Aldius.

If downstream consumers report missing tracking events, first confirm the webhook dispatcher is healthy by checking the retry queue depth; anything above 500 indicates a stalled worker. Restart the dispatcher only after draining in-flight deliveries, otherwise duplicate events will reach carrier integrations. After restart, replay the failed window in ascending timestamp order and verify sequence numbers are contiguous. Log the replay in the release channel and attach the dispatcher build token, shown below.

pipeline stamp: htk3_69f

Subject: Night-shift access — support team

Night shift: the main doors at Corven Plaza lock at 21:00. Support team members arriving after that must use the side entrance by the bike racks. Don't prop the door. Badge readers are offline overnight until further notice, so entry is by keypad only. The current keypad code for the side entrance is below.

turnstile pass: bdg-QZV-3

## Tide-Table Widget — Contacts

The Moonsill tide-table widget on the Harbrook Ferries site is owned by the Coastal Data team, not the web platform group. For incorrect tide predictions, contact Coastal Data directly, since they manage the upstream Saltmere feed. For rendering bugs (overlapping labels, broken charts), raise a ticket first and wait one business day. For anything ambiguous, or if a ticket stalls, write to the widget maintainers at the address below.

escalation mailbox, bafog-fafog: ulador@paliqlabs.internal

Handover note — for warehouse shift lead

The antique longcase clock from the Ashwell estate goes back to Merriton Horology for the escapement repair tomorrow. It's crated upright in bay 6; keep it upright at all times, no stacking. Pellgrave Transport collects between 09:00 and 11:00. Paperwork is in the sleeve on the crate. The courier hand-over instruction follows.

handover note for yagef-bagep: the drudor pelius courier leaves the kasdor zorvan norir ledger at gate 8016 under passcode 755406